Will brought a 144-ounce cooler filled with water to soccer practice. He used 16 ounces from the cooler to fill his water bottle. He then took out 16 plastic cups for his teammates and put the same amount of water in each cup.

Find and graph the number of ounces of water, [tex]$x$[/tex], that Will could have put in each cup. Use the drawing tool(s) to form the correct answer on the provided number line.

Answer :

Let's solve the problem step-by-step:

1. Start with the total amount of water: We know that the cooler initially contained 144 ounces of water.

2. Subtract the water used for the bottle:
- Will used 16 ounces from the cooler to fill his water bottle.
- To find out how much water is left, subtract 16 ounces from 144 ounces:
[tex]\[ 144 - 16 = 128 \][/tex]
- So, there are 128 ounces of water remaining in the cooler.

3. Distribute the remaining water equally among the cups:
- Will has 16 plastic cups for his teammates.
- We need to divide the 128 ounces of remaining water equally among these 16 cups.
- Calculate how many ounces each cup will contain by dividing the remaining water by the number of cups:
[tex]\[ \frac{128}{16} = 8 \][/tex]

4. Result:
- Each cup can be filled with 8 ounces of water.

Now, if you are to graph this on a number line:
- Mark the number 8 on the number line as the amount of water in each cup.
